Chris Brett and James Punnett are the driving force behind MotorShare, a car subscription platform for exotic vehicles based in Auckland.

The platform allows members to choose from a range of plans which can be paid for monthly or yearly, granting them access to some of the world’s most sought after cars for 10, 20, 30, or more, days per year, depending on the plan selected.

“Our Silver Plan offers access to cars in our essential, premium range, private collection (after 12 months). Upgrading to a Gold or Platinum membership allows access to all collections right away!” says Chris.

Though the concept of an exotic car subscription company exists elsewhere in the world, Chris and James discovered the concept is new to New Zealand.

“Over lunch one day, we came up with the idea of MotorShare, to help all Kiwis enjoy exotic cars without breaking the bank”.

“It’s not very often you think of an idea and no one’s doing it. It is an expensive business to set up with a lot of complexities around getting insurance so that’s probably why no-one was doing it in the first place. But we just ran with it, bought a couple of cars, and wanted to see how things went, really”.

“The first car that we started with was the Porsche GT4 followed by the Mercedes AMG GT and our Audi R8. We have thirteen cars in total and are always looking at additional cars to add”.

They have also introduced a new syndicate programme to help expand their fleet of cars, where anyone is able to own a share in a vehicle. A share gives them a number of days per year for that specific vehicle. Syndicate owners can then enjoy the car and also allow members to use an allocation of their days to help cover some of those expenses relating to the vehicle.

The MotorShare headquarters can be found tucked away at the Wiri Station Road Business Park, off Wiri Station Road. They moved to Wiri in late 2023 and have expanded to a team of four with Cole and Joe joining the business.

“Wiri is a good location as we’re close to the airport and can service our South Island customers that travel up to Auckland. We operate a shuttle for these customers from the airport.

Additionally, prices in the Wiri area are good compared to the city or the North Shore”.

MotorShare is quickly growing their membership base. A range of Porsches (GT4, 911 & Boxster), McLaren 650S, Nissan GTR R35, Mercedes G63 (G-Wagon), Mercedes AMG-GT, Aston Martin DB9 and Jaguar F-Type S are part of the fleet and waiting to be taken for a spin.

“We operate a membership waitlist, interview new members, and put them through the usual checks before they can sign a contract”.

“At the moment, we are car-heavy, so there’s plenty of availability for new members. Once we get to a magic number, we will cap the numbers to ensure it stays an exclusive club”.
